1.3.2 JSON字符串获取List实体类两层通用方法 publicstatic<T>List<T>parseSyncResult(Stringresult,Class<T>clazz)throwsException{JSONObjectjsonObject=JSONObject.parseObject(result);JSONArrayjsonArray=jsonObject.getJSONObject("content").getJSONArray("data");// content和data根据实际情况调整returnJSON.parseA...
2.$.getJSON 对于服务器返回的JSON字符串,如果jquery异步请求将type(一般为这个配置属性)设 为“json”,或者利 用$.getJSON()方法获得服务器返回,那么就不需要eval()方法了,因为 这时候得到的结果已经是json对象了,只需直接调用该对象即可,这 里以$.getJSON方法为例说 明数据处理方法: $.getJSON("http://...
(1)简介 get_json_object(json_txt, path) 参数1:需要解析的json字符串 参数2:路径,需要解析出来的当前json串中的路径 (2)json路径 根目录:最外层的目录 $:Root object 根目录 .:Child operator 子节点 []: Subscript operator for array 取数组元素的,数组通过下标取,中括号中放的就是数组的下标 json中...
cJSON_Parse();调用了cJSON_ParseWithOpts(),只是后两个输入参数为0。这对我们的分析影响不大。先大概看一下cJSON_ParseWithOpts(); /* * 解析json字符串 * value:字符串 * 成功则返回cjson结构体 */ CJSON_PUBLIC(cJSON *) cJSON_ParseWithOpts(const char *value, const char **return_parse_end,...
使用cJSON解析JSON字符串 一、为何选择cJSON 我们在使用JSON格式时,如果只是处理简单的协议,可以依据JSON格式,通过对字符串的操作来进行解析与创建。然而随着协议逐渐复杂起来,经常会遇到一些未考虑周全的地方,需要进一步的完善解析方法,此时,使用比较完善的JSON解析库的需求就提出来了。
JSON(Javascript Object Notation)是一种轻量级的数据交换格式,易于阅读和编写,也易于机器解析和生成。 结构: a.名称/值 的集合,Json对象是键值对构成,类似于map。其键为普通字符串,值可以为任意类型,如数字、逻辑值、文本、数组对象、Json对象、null等。
json字符串解析函数,get_json_object ,json_tuple 以上两个函数的用法可以看这两篇文章 0 赞同 · 0 评论文章 因为有的从业务系统传过来的json字符串带有其它的字符,导致json字符串到数据库存储之后并不规范无法直接使用相应的json处理函数解析,这时候我们就需要借助字符串处理函数,比如:字符串分割,字符串替换等函数...
一、前言:为了使用简单方便,可以通过下载cJSON文件来解析JOSN字符串比较简单方便,而且cJSON文件只有一个cJSON.c和cJSON.h两个文件,使用起来效率比较高。...
out.println("City: "+city);}}在这个例子中,我们首先定义了一个JSON字符串。接着,我们使用JSON库...